Ugo Ukah : Brazil Is Very Close Now!
Published: October 15, 2013
Jagiellonia Białystok central defender Ugo Ukah has praised the Super Eagles players for their heroic performance against Ethiopia last weekend in the World Cup play - offs.
“Another great victory that confirms how the team is responding well to the guidance of the coach! Brazil is very close now!
“They should approach the second leg the same way they did in Ethiopia plus we will have the support of the fans, so we should be very positive about the second leg
“I spoke to the coach recently and I hope to join the team soon.
“I have good condition at the moment and playing regularly in my club so hopefully I will be given another chance soon, ”Ukah told allnigeriasoccer.com.
29 - year - old Ugo Ukah made his debut for Nigeria back in 2011 in a friendly against Zambia.
He has played 7 matches in the ongoing season for Jagiellonia Biaå‚ystok , who occupy the 6th position in the championship.
